Description
[0001] FIG. 1 is a front, right, top perspective view of a television receiver showing our new design in which the display screen is not extended;
[0002] FIG. 2 is a front view thereof;
[0003] FIG. 3 is a rear view thereof;
[0004] FIG. 4 is a left side view thereof;
[0005] FIG. 5 is a right side view thereof;
[0006] FIG. 6 is a top plan view thereof;
[0007] FIG. 7 is a bottom plan view thereof;
[0008] FIG. 8 is an exploded view thereof;
[0009] FIG. 9 is a front, right, top perspective view thereof in which the display screen is extended;
[0010] FIG. 10 is a front view thereof;
[0011] FIG. 11 is a rear view thereof;
[0012] FIG. 12 is a left side view thereof;
[0013] FIG. 13 is a right side view thereof;
[0014] FIG. 14 is a top plan view thereof;
[0015] FIG. 15 is a bottom plan view thereof; and,
[0016] FIG. 16 is an exploded view thereof.
[0017] The broken lines depict portions of the television receiver that form no part of the claimed design. The solid line shown in FIGS. 7 and 15 bisecting the bottom surface of the article represents a seam that is coplanar with the adjacent surfaces and does not depict any change in contour or depth.
Claims
The ornamental design for a television receiver as shown and described.
